Output 3dab6ba15cbaab73488e7fa9c33b670505f2a284f4ab8b6bdb9d619e7e26012a:4

value
428876
script pubkey
OP_0 OP_PUSHBYTES_20 1f10ccfcfa479a60cf8062b7d4c145d85886097b
address
bc1qrugvel86g7dxpnuqv2mafs29mpvgvztmgjpemc
transaction
3dab6ba15cbaab73488e7fa9c33b670505f2a284f4ab8b6bdb9d619e7e26012a